  22. [quote name="btq96r" post="1156037" timestamp="1402070440"]I haven't had a Comcast modem since I started service with them back in November. This is what I have set up in my home. [url="http://www.amazon.com/gp/product/B004XC6GJ0/ref=oh_details_o01_s00_i00?ie=UTF8&psc=1"]http://www.amazon.com/gp/product/B004XC6GJ0/ref=oh_details_o01_s00_i00?ie=UTF8&psc=1[/url] and [url="http://www.amazon.com/gp/product/B00A3YN0Z0/ref=oh_details_o01_s00_i03?ie=UTF8&psc=1"]http://www.amazon.com/gp/product/B00A3YN0Z0/ref=oh_details_o01_s00_i03?ie=UTF8&psc=1[/url] They make routers that can run in the 5GHz range now, but the one listed has been fine for my wi-fi needs. The modem specs claim it can handle 172Mbps download/131Mbps upload; the router claims up to 300Mbps. That's well beyond any internet package a normal house will need for a good while. I fully expect to have these two things running wherever I live for about 5 more years. All you need to give Comcast is the MAC address for the router- they don't need anything else to send the signal to it and from there. After that, you're in charge of your own network. It's not difficult at all and if you have any questions, PM me and I can walk you through it. A bonus I've noticed is that I never have to reset modem or router. They function flawlessly and at a combined price coming in under $100, they pay for themselves after the 14th month.[/quote] This is what I've done. Pays for itself AND you're in control. Win/Win. Just make sure they don't keep charging a rental fee. It was a nightmare to get them to refund me the rental fees and take my personally bought modem off Comcast's equipment list.
